Dies ist eine mobil optimierte Seite, die schnell lädt. Wenn Sie die Seite ohne Optimierung laden möchten, dann klicken Sie auf diesen Text.

NO-IP Account-Renew Script 1.0

    Nobody is reading this thread right now.
Bei mir funktioniert die Version auch nicht mehr, bei Darkstar läuft das neue Script scheinbar auch mit Python 2.7.xx…. Wenn ich es richtig verstanden habe….
 
Ich weiß wirklich nicht wo euer Problem liegen könnte, es funktioniert einwandfrei hier.

Code:
noip-renew - Version: 210517
[2021/05/18 22:44:53] - Debug level: 2
[2021/05/18 22:44:53] - Opening https://www.noip.com/login...
[2021/05/18 22:44:56] - Logging in...
[2021/05/18 22:45:03] - Opening https://my.noip.com/#!/dynamic-dns...
[2021/05/18 22:45:05] - xxx.sytes.net expires in 19 days
[2021/05/18 22:45:05] - xxx.sytes.net expires in 19 days
[2021/05/18 22:45:05] - xxx.sytes.net expires in 19 days
[2021/05/18 22:45:05] - xxx.sytes.net expires in 19 days
[2021/05/18 22:45:05] - xxx.sytes.net expires in 19 days
[2021/05/18 22:45:06] - Confirmed hosts: 0

heißt dies, ohne Phyton3 geht nun nichts mehr?

habe die ganze Zeit noch VERSION=180807 laufen gehabt.

Mein altes Script funktioniert gar nicht mehr!
 
Das noip-renew aus dem git braucht Python 3.6
Python:
#!/usr/bin/env python3
Die alten Skripte funktionieren wegen der letzten Änderung auf noip.com nicht mehr
 
Kann ich nicht bestätigen, bei mir läufts am PI unter Python 2.7

Edit: Sehe gerade das er auch P3 installiert hat, könnte also sein das es nur damit geht.
 
Zuletzt bearbeitet:
Was bedeuted der Cron Eintrag? Ist der bei jedem gleich oder generiert der sich nach dem Ablaufdatum des Accounts?
 
Das ist ein Statischer Cron.

Siehe:

CRONJOB="30 0 * * * $INSTEXE $LOGDIR"
 
Nein. Ist nicht statisch. Das Skript erstellt den Cronjob, in dem es von den "Expires in xx Days" 6 Tage abzieht und dann einen neuen macht
Zeile 106 -110:
 
Moin ,

heute war es dann soweit und einer meiner dyns sollte updated werden.
./noip-renew-xxx.sh
noip-renew - Version: 210517
[2021/05/19 08:53:22] - Debug level: 2
[2021/05/19 08:53:22] - Opening ...
[2021/05/19 08:53:24] - Logging in...
[2021/05/19 08:53:30] - Opening ...
[2021/05/19 08:53:31] - xxx.zapto.org expires in 7 days
[2021/05/19 08:53:31] - Updating xxx.zapto.org
[2021/05/19 08:53:34] - xxxx.hopto.org expires in 6 days
[2021/05/19 08:53:34] - Updating xxxx.hopto.org
[2021/05/19 08:53:35] - Message: element click intercepted: Element <button class="btn btn-labeled btn-success" _v-78c9c52b="">...</button> is not
ickable at point (1076, 548). Other element would receive the click: <div class="modal fade modal-update in" tabindex="-1" role="dialog" aria-hidde
"false" style="display: block;">...</div>
(Session info: headless chrome=90.0.4430.212)

Da scheint noch irgendwas krumm zu sein beim Button.
 
Er Schreibt zwar jedes mal die Crond neu (muss man auch nicht so gut finden), aber da ändert sich nichts.

30 0 * * * /usr/local/bin/noip-renew-root.sh /var/log/noip-renew/root <--- Dabei bleibt es.
 
Hallo,

ich habe es nun auch soweit am Laufen mit einem Crontab Fehler. Er sagt: User unknow.

Wo liegt mein (Denk)fehler?

noip-renew - Version: 210517
[2021/05/19 09:08:32] - Debug level: 2
[2021/05/19 09:08:32] - Opening ...
[2021/05/19 09:08:39] - Logging in...
[2021/05/19 09:08:54] - Opening ...
[2021/05/19 09:08:56] - xxx.myddns.me expires in 11 days
[2021/05/19 09:08:56] - Confirmed hosts: 0
crontab: user `-l' unknown
crontab: user `-' unknown
crontab: user `-' unknown
crontab: user `-l' unknown
 
Hat es vielleicht damit zu tun das nichts ins Log geschrieben wird?
 
Habe in der Datei noip-renew-skd.sh bei user=root eingetragen.
Jetzt läuft es ohne Fehlermeldung durch
noip-renew - Version: 210517
[2021/05/19 10:57:18] - Debug level: 2
[2021/05/19 10:57:18] - Opening ...
[2021/05/19 10:57:24] - Logging in...
[2021/05/19 10:57:35] - Opening ...
[2021/05/19 10:57:37] - xxx.myddns.me expires in 11 days
[2021/05/19 10:57:38] - Confirmed hosts: 0
 
Poste doch mal den kompletten Fehlercode
 
Für die Nutzung dieser Website sind Cookies erforderlich. Du musst diese akzeptieren, um die Website weiter nutzen zu können. Erfahre mehr…